SYNOPSIS

Drake The third sister, Abigail, has a very deep bond with the water and its inhabitants, especially dolphins. His studies on language and customs of these animals have been traveling around the world. In one of these trips met Aleksandr Volstov, in Interpol agent, as sexy as implacable, which ended up breaking his heart.

Aleksadr is now in Sea Haven, following the trail of art thieves. Abigail, who is able to get only his voice that those around her to tell the truth, hear the sincerity in his words, but is afraid to suffer again.



OPINION OF BETHLEHEM MARQUEZ

Hidalgo is the third installment of the Drake Sisters . In it, Christine Feehan tells the story of seven girls with some very special gifts. The first two installments had occasion to read in the club reading and we liked a lot, so we went for the third and we were not disappointed. In

Magic in the wind, the brief presentation of the volume of Drake sisters, we had the chance to meet Sarah, the first of the sisters and triggers the prophecy.

Snow in the penumbra knew the story of Kate, the writer of the family, a story in which the sisters faced a powerful and evil force that consolidated the love between Kate and Matt, his friend children.

In this third installment, Christine Feehan presents Abigail whose uncanny knack of telling the truth to keep it away from people and instead, very close to the depths of the ocean and its inhabitants with whom they feel more comfortable and "safe." The relationship between her and Alexander, with whom he had a past relationship is very complicated because Aleksadr was not entirely honest with her and now will be difficult to regain trust. His fault was kidnapped, confined and tortured, and even though Alek helped her escape, she can not trust him again.

But fate makes their paths cross again. Alek pursues art thieves and Abigail will be mixed inadvertently in this shady deal. Alek has the opportunity to re-conquer it, and not waste it.

This series of sisters Drake is completely different from the series Dark reseñábamos few days ago one of their deliveries. I like Feehan's treatment of witchcraft, relationship and connection between the sisters and how they face the dark forces. The relationship established between them and their future partners is original and different from each other. By this I come to refer to is not an author of those scenes that tell the sprocket, there is no difference in how this love to the girl, and maintain that relationship or carry out, but each character has a way own act differently. The argument is interesting, intense, very well written-nothing do with the dark series, and keeps you stuck to the end, wondering what awaits them the rest of the sisters.

A novel very entertaining and recommended especially for those topics we like witchcraft.
